
Hardback
|
Arabic,English
Published 17 Apr 2025
Save $10.17
- RRP $129.77
- $119.60
2 results
$10.17off
Hardback
|
Arabic,English
Published 17 Apr 2025
Save $10.17
$1.88off
Paperback
|
Arabic,English
Published 17 Apr 2025
Save $1.88